Your work profile

  • As a Manager in our DTPMI – I&S Team you’ll build and nurture positive working relationships with teams and clients with the intention to exceed client expectations: -
  • As part of our growing Integrations & Separations team you will work closely with clients in order to help them deliver on their people and deal objectives through the M&A lifecycle. A critical part of this activity, is assisting, supporting and helping our clients to constructively navigate the people challenges faced through the integration and separation process.
  • You will deliver services ranging from the development of integration or separation strategies to supporting on day 1 planning and post-deal implementation programme delivery. You will support transactions across all industry sectors including Digital, Technology and Financial Services.
  • Support our clients and their in-house functional teams through integration / separation processes, playing a key role on small to mid-scale assignments and forming a key part of the delivery team on larger projects
  • Support day-to-day Programme Management Office activities on small / mid-sized engagements including tracking of key integration/separation activities, status reports, risks, actions, issues and dependency (RAID logs), benefits tracking, cost tracking, etc.
  • Support the coordination of functional workstream(s) in fulfilling their programme objectives and deliverables
  • Engage with colleagues and client senior management to support the development of integration / separation strategies
  • Prepare inputs for and record outputs from client workshops and wider stakeholder management activities and maintain a hands-on approach to ensure deadlines are met and key deliverables are always accurate
  • Prepare reporting on overall programme progress for senior executives, including risk mitigation and issue resolution proposals
